The project shall be served by a single public road, <br /> referred to as Lodge Trail, extending approximately 4,000 ft. from Damascus Church <br /> Road. The proposed roadway shall be located within a 60 ft. wide easement and shall be <br /> constructed in accordance with applicable NC Department of Transportation public road <br /> standards. Approximately 14.6 acres of land area (33%) associated with the project is to <br /> be preserved as common open space owned by a local home owners association. <br /> Development the public roadway shall involve crossing of a stream and identified special <br /> flood hazard areas. <br /> i <br /> (hereafter `the project'). <br /> Broyhill Wiles Building and Developing INC. and their engineers, MacConnell & Associates, PC <br /> (hereafter `the applicants') have submitted applications proposing the extension of the proposed roadway, j <br /> which will extend across a water feature, specifically West Price Creek, located within the project.
